    New Waratahs Head of performance - two horse race?

    Is RA waiting for a decision on the new Tahs Head of performance to announce dispersal of Rebels players? According to this article Nick Stiles is a front runner and if selected may convince majority of Rebels players to agree to go to the Tahs.

    welve months out from hosting the British and Irish Lions and the Waratahs are in no-man’s land, but the NSW board will try to rectify their shambolic planning ahead of 2025 by naming a head of performance by week’s end.

    It’s believed former Wallaby and Rebels general manager Nick Stiles, as well as ex-Fiji international turned Wallabies slayer and Flying Fijians coach Simon Raiwalui, are the two front-runners.

    It’s understood Harlequins director of performance Billy Millard withdrew from consideration while Andy Friend couldn’t commit to a full-time role.
